Join us for a 5 day adventure-seeking trip to Michigan's Upper Peninsula, where we boondock in the Hiawatha & Ottawa National Forests, while hitting up trails in Sleeping Bear Dunes, Tahquamenon Falls, Pictured Rocks, and the Porcupine Mountains! This travel vlog contains highlights from our camp locations, scenic drives (including Mackinac Bridge), hikes, and other shenanigans we got into.
